Causal Associations of Circulating Helicobacter pylori Antibodies with 5 Skin Disorders: A Mendelian Randomization Analysis

Helicobacter pylori (H. pylori) infection, a prevalent bacterial ailment affecting the stomach, has been linked to diverse gastrointestinal disorders. Nevertheless, the correlation between H. pylori infection and skin disorders has not been definitively established. We use Mendelian randomization analysis to explore causal relationships with seven pylori antibody levels and five skin diseases, such as rosacea, psoriasis, alopecia areata, pruritus and urticaria. The primary analytical method employed was inverse variance weighted (IVW), and a sensitivity analysis was executed to evaluate the robustness of the primary findings. The results revealed a positive causal relationship between H. pylori catalase antibody levels and AA (IVW: OR = 1.32, 95% CI = 1.07 to 1.61, P = 0.008), as well as a positive causal relationship between H. pylori UreA antibody levels and pruritus (IVW: OR = 1.17, 95% CI = 1.05 to 1.31, P = 0.006). These effects were robust to sensitivity analyses. Our results suggested that H. pylori infection was a risk factor for AA and pruritus. This finding may have implications for the prevention and treatment of these skin disorders.
